ASLA Sierra Chapter DxLA Presents Allyship in the Workplace

Allyship is the actions, behaviors, and practices that we can take to support, amplify, and advocate with other people, especially with individuals who don’t belong to the same social identity groups as each other. Our two panelists, Zayn and April, will discuss the value of allyship in the workplace, [...]

Dolores Street Pollinator Boulevard Community Workday

Join ASLA-NCC along with With Honey in the Heart for a community workday on Dolores Street Pollinator Boulevard! The Dolores Street Pollinator Boulevard is an urban resiliency project which transferred islands plagued with brown turf and invasive weeds on San Francisco’s landmark Dolores Street to smart pollinator plantings that [...]
